Carlsbad entered their tilt with Poway on Thursday with three cons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with four. They came out on top against the Poway Titans by a score of 2-0. For the Lancers, this counts as revenge for the 3-2 loss the Titans walked away with the last time they faced one another back in September of 2022.
The 2-0 doesn't show just how dominant Carlsbad was: they took both sets by at least eight points. After all that action, the final score was 25-13, 25-17.
Carlsbad has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won eight of their last nine games, which provided a nice bump to their 10-4 record this season. As for Poway, their defeat dropped their record down to 3-6.
